DescribeAlarmsInput
import type { DescribeAlarmsInput } from "https://aws-api.deno.dev/v0.3/services/cloudwatch.ts?docs=full";
§Properties
Use this parameter to filter the results of the operation to only those alarms that use a certain alarm action. For example, you could specify the ARN of an SNS topic to find all alarms that send notifications to that topic.
An alarm name prefix. If you specify this parameter, you receive information about all alarms that have names that start with this prefix.
If this parameter is specified, you cannot specify AlarmNames
.
If you use this parameter and specify the name of a composite alarm, the operation returns information about the "children" alarms of the alarm you specify.
These are the metric alarms and composite alarms referenced in the AlarmRule
field of the composite alarm that you specify in ChildrenOfAlarmName
.
Information about the composite alarm that you name in ChildrenOfAlarmName
is not returned.
If you specify ChildrenOfAlarmName
, you cannot specify any other parameters in the request except for MaxRecords
and NextToken
.
If you do so, you receive a validation error.
Note:
Only the Alarm Name
, ARN
, StateValue
(OK/ALARM/INSUFFICIENT_DATA), and StateUpdatedTimestamp
information are returned by this operation when you use this parameter.
To get complete information about these alarms, perform another DescribeAlarms
operation and specify the parent alarm names in the AlarmNames
parameter.
The token returned by a previous call to indicate that there is more data available.
If you use this parameter and specify the name of a metric or composite alarm, the operation returns information about the "parent" alarms of the alarm you specify.
These are the composite alarms that have AlarmRule
parameters that reference the alarm named in ParentsOfAlarmName
.
Information about the alarm that you specify in ParentsOfAlarmName
is not returned.
If you specify ParentsOfAlarmName
, you cannot specify any other parameters in the request except for MaxRecords
and NextToken
.
If you do so, you receive a validation error.
Note:
Only the Alarm Name and ARN are returned by this operation when you use this parameter.
To get complete information about these alarms, perform another DescribeAlarms
operation and specify the parent alarm names in the AlarmNames
parameter.
Specify this parameter to receive information only about alarms that are currently in the state that you specify.
